Fit to find the value of an unknown parameter
Mostra commenti meno recenti
Hi. I want to determine the value of a paramter (H) using a fit to measurements. I am assuming a list of H values.
A=0.1;
B=0.5;
C=100;
x; % x - coordinates
P1; % Measured data
H=0.0001:0.00005:0.05; % Assuming some values of H
for i=1:length(H)
i
P2=H(i)*(((1/A)*log(x.*H(i)/C))+B); % Estimation
R2(i)=rsquared(P1,P2) % Calculating the R2 value using rsquared function
end
I want the same number of P2 estimations as the number of assumed H values. I don't get it here. I want to save the values of R2 and select the value of H which gives R2=0.95.
Risposta accettata
Più risposte (0)
Categorie
Scopri di più su Linear and Nonlinear Regression in Centro assistenza e File Exchange
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!